Ethan owns a farm house. His farm house contains cows and buffaloes. The total number of
pav-90 [236]

TOTAL NO.OF ANIMALS IN FARMHOUSE=42

RATIO OF COW : BUFFALO=5:9

LET THE NO.OF COWS BE 5X AND BUFFALOES BE 9X

5X + 9X =42

14X=42

X = 42/14

X= 3

TOTAL NO.OF COWS = 5 x 3 =15

TOTAL NO.OF BUFFALOES = 9 x 3 = 27
